Gold funds shine with 16.83 per cent returns in a year. But will the lustre last?
The yield from gold funds offered by mutual fund houses has touched 16.83 per cent in the 12 months ending July 30, outperforming equity and debt fund categories. Gold has a negative relationship with equity. In times of volatility or crisis in the stock markets, gold as an investment performs…
